zoukankan      html  css  js  c++  java
  • 路过Haxe

    刚才在看Nape的时候,看到Haxe的代码,意外的感觉到亲切。

    因为之前写过as2代码,最近学习了python,所以对haxe看起来很亲切,于是路过一下写了个HelloWorld。

    另外,估计很长时间不能用蛋疼这个词了,同时也敬告各位,不要随意使用这样的词,因为会像我一样应验的。

    当然,我只是最近胖了很多斤导致裤子变小而压迫到的。

    且把闲话休提,来二两代码吧,如下:

    package;
    import flash.display.Sprite;
    import flash.text.TextField;
    
    class HelloWorld extends Sprite{
        
        function new(){
            super();
            var tf:TextField = new TextField();
            tf.text = "Hello Haxe!";
            tf.x = 200;
            tf.y = 100;
            addChild(tf);
        }
    
        static function main():Void{
            flash.Lib.current.addChild(new HelloWorld());
        }
    }

    开发环境:Sublime Text 2, 插件的话ctrl+shift+p打开命令窗口,输入install,回车,搜索haxe就可以了,安装完成就要重启一下。

    编译的话去Haxe官网下载一个Haxe的安装程序,安装完之后他会在系统的环境变量里面直接添加一个叫做HAXEPATH的环境变量,所以可以直接在CMD里面使用。

    haxe -swf hello.swf -main HelloWorld

    -swf后面跟的是编译后的文件名字,-main是主程序文件名。

    之后你就可以在文件夹里面看到编译生成的swf了。

  • 相关阅读:
    类加载
    LinkedList插入排序实现
    99乘法表
    关于IO流的抽象类
    分解质因数
    Struts2小demo遇到的几个问题
    Tomcat设置欢迎页问题
    数据库迁移
    EF – 1.模式
    正则表达式
  • 原文地址:https://www.cnblogs.com/adoontheway/p/3168671.html
Copyright © 2011-2022 走看看